Solo Events are limited-time competitions in which each Trainer participates individually. They are based on completing several tiers, each having three set goals with different requirements, and a prize awarded upon completing each tier.

Mechanics

Each tier has several items that must be collected. Items are each limited to a set number per a given timeframe, with a cooldown period needed before collecting more. Whenever items are received, a notification appears in the middle of the screen. If all available items for that period are already collected, the notification indicates how much time is left until the next can be collected. Each individual item can also be bought in exchange for Gems Icon.png Gems, by pressing the  Gems Icon.png /Item   button under the item.

Requirements

An explanation of the requirements for an item can be seen by tapping on the i button. Item collection has a base pool from which item collection is taken. The pool consists of the maximum number of items that can ever be collected at one time. Each tier begins with the base pool being available for collection. From that point, each item has an internal cooldown time until the next item can be obtained. The cooldown time is set for individual item collection up to the maximum accumulatively. This means that items can be collected at a rate of 1 per cooldown time or collect total pool once time has been exceeded for the pool without collecting any items. The cooldown times are also visible by two methods in-game. The first method is seen briefly on a notification upon collecting the last item available in a pool. The second method is by viewing the event screen where times for next available collection are shown under each item required.

Example

There are two methods for collecting items. For instance, if one had a required task of collecting 20 Food and the cooldown was 1 minute with a pool of 10, one could collect 10 at the beginning of the tier and then:

  • 1 item every 1 minute OR
  • 10 items every 10 minutes. By figuring out and waiting total pool time before collecting, the whole pool will become available for collection. [1 minute (cooldown) x 10 (pool)= 10 minutes]
